NEW FOR 2014: RANGER Z520C INTRACOASTAL

Built for saltwater and equipped for serious competition
Serious bass anglers, whether they fish for paychecks or pride, recognize the Ranger Z520C Comanche as the finest tournament boat in production today. It’s a belief reinforced by the millions of dollars won in competition since its 2013 debut.

New for 2014, Ranger Boats introduces the all-new Ranger Z520C Intracoastal, a saltwater-ready incarnation of the legendary boat brand’s flagship. The Z520C Intracoastal raises the bar for inshore fishing boats with proven performance, a wealth of integrated, industry leading fishing features plus distinctive, best-in-class styling that might make an inshore angler feel a little like a top professional bass angler in more ways than one.

“There’s a reason why a tournament bass boat is designed the way it is and why, when there’s significant money on the line, the layout of the boat can make all of the difference in the world,” said Ranger Pro and acclaimed saltwater guide Billy Nicholas. “I’ve spent a lot of time in the Z21 Intracoastal and really didn’t think it could get much better, but this new Z520C design has absolutely blown me away.”

Offering more fishing space than any other boat in its class, the Ranger Z520C Intracoastal measures 20 feet, 9 inches in length while being rated for 250 horsepower. Available with a wide range of precision-matched, factory-rigged outboards, the boat comes standard with a Minn Kota Rip Tide 80BGH trolling motor, 8-inch jackplate, power trim and an on-board 15×3 charger. The Ranger Z520C Intracoastal is highly customizable to suit the needs of the most discriminating inshore anglers, with factory-installed options like trim tabs, anchoring systems and flush-mounted electronics all available.

More than just a retread of its freshwater-fishing counterpart, the all-new Ranger Z520C Intracoastal introduces some new features to the saltwater market to enhance all aspects of boat ownership. In keeping with the sleek, aggressive styling and striking good looks, the Z520C Intracoastal represents one of the most visually stunning saltwater-specific fishing boats on the market today.

A new Soft Touch Skid-Resistant interior not only provides improved aesthetics, but also delivers a surface that stays cooler, dries faster and is easier on the knees and feet than traditional non-skid applications. The new covering provides a cushioning for anglers and represents a significant technological advance that’s not only durable, but visually striking as well.

“This Soft Touch Skid-Resistant covering on the decks and floors compared to other boats is like comparing the cotton shirt I used to wear fishing versus the high-tech performance materials I wear now,” said Nicholas. “It’s just a lot more comfortable and enjoyable to fish with this feature-packed design.”

The best-in-class styling doesn’t just stop with the boat, either. The new boat rides down the road on its own custom-built aluminum Ranger Trail® tandem-axle trailer with matching fiberglass fenders. Not just for good looks, the matching fenders make it easy to load the boat and help protect the boat when trailering. Designed and built in the same factory to the same, exacting standards as all Ranger boats, Ranger Trail® trailers are custom aligned with individually balanced wheels, equipped with torsion axle suspensions and locking, swing-away tongues. The trailer also features LED lights, aluminum wheels, retractable tie downs, a center swing jack stand, and Ranger’s COOL Hub® lubrication system as standard equipment.

The Ranger Z520C Intracoastal also shares many acclaimed features with its bass-fishing sibling, from its proven hull design to storage options. At the bow anglers will find built-in cup and tool holders to keep gear and other essentials organized, as well as two pedestal chair locations allowing anglers to pick their most comfortable fishing position. The bow’s off-set location for mounting electronics also helps keep cumbersome trolling motor cables tucked neatly out of the way, which is especially important given that the boat can easily accommodate electronics with massive 12-inch screen sizes. In addition, the navigation lights are built into the deck of the boat, eliminating the need for a forward light post and complementing the clean, unobstructed look of the bow.

Underneath the padded front casting deck, the port, center and starboard rod storages feature a lined, gel-coated interior that are linked to the patent-pending Power Ventilation Rod Storage (PVRS) System, which circulates air from a blower throughout the storage boxes to help dry out tackle and equipment after a busy day on the water. With room for up to 20 rods as long as 8 feet, 6 inches, the rod storages also feature integrated tackle management and improved access from outside of the boat. There is also tackle storage located just forward of the driver’s console and an insulated cooler built-into the front deck step.

Integrated measuring boards and tool holders flank both sides of the front deck step inside the cockpit of the Ranger Z520C Intracoastal, providing a centrally located work station. Available in single- and dual-console configurations, the driver’s console can accommodate 12-inch electronics in the dash without the need for exterior mounts or brackets. The boat also comes standard with an adjustable driver’s seat built on slides to accommodate anglers of all heights and intuitive features such as the Battery Selector Switch, which allows all electrical draw to be cut off with the flip of a switch when the boat is parked and also allows anglers to select which battery is used for starting in the event that the cranking battery is ever drained. Other standout features include a remote drain plug and innovative, divided livewell with sliding splash guards to minimize splash and make culling fish easier and more efficient.
